Architectural
Specifications - WMP-F
|
ENGLISH |
|
Fiberglass shall be as outlined in the North American
Insulation Manufacturing Association (NAIMA 202-96) specification,
or equal, with an R-value of ______ when not compressed. The
fiberglass shall be faced with ______, as specified below, on one
side. The composite of fiberglass and facing shall have
surface burning characteristics not to exceed 25 flame spread and 50
smoke developed when tested in accordance with Underwriters
Laboratories 723 test method or ASTM E 84 test method.
Facing shall be composed of 0.0015"
white polypropylene film, a reinforcing layer and 0.0003" aluminum foil. The product
shall be reinforced with a 4x4 bi-directional scrim. The resulting facing shall have a
water vapor transmission rate of 0.02 US perm (ASTM E96, Procedure A), a beach puncture of
130 scale units and a mullen burst of 90 psi. Tensile strength shall be 45# in the machine
direction and 45# in the cross-machine direction. |

METRIC |
|
Fiberglass shall be as outlined in the North American
Insulation Manufacturing Association (formerly T.I.M.A )
specification, or P.E.B. 202 or equal, with an R-value of ______
when not compressed. The fiberglass shall be faced on one
side. The composite of fiberglass and facing shall have
surface burning characteristics not to exceed 25 flame spread and 50
smoke developed when tested in accordance with Underwriters
Laboratories 723 test method or ASTM E 84 test method.
Facing shall be composed of 38.1 micron white polypropylene
film, a reinforcing layer and 7.6 micron aluminum foil. The product shall be reinforced
with a 16/100 mm x 16/100 mm bi-directional scrim. The resulting facing shall have a water
vapor transmission rate of 1.15 ng/N·s (ASTM E96, Procedure A), a beach
puncture of 3.9 Joules and a mullen burst of 6.3 kg/cm². Tensile strength shall be 7.9
kn/m in the machine direction and 7.9 kn/m in the cross-machine direction.
